Content is King: Craft a Killer Content Strategy

At the heart of successful Facebook lead generation lies a well-defined content strategy. Your content should be tailored to the specific needs and interests of your target audience—in this case, marketers. Focus on creating valuable content that makes their jobs easier and more efficient. Think blog posts, presentations, ebooks, and case studies that address their pain points and provide actionable solutions.

Diversify Your Content Mix: Lead-Gen and Beyond

Don’t limit yourself to lead-generating content alone. Diversify your content mix with a blend of non-lead-generating posts to attract and engage potential customers. Share industry news, tips, and thought leadership pieces that demonstrate your expertise and build trust. This approach helps you nurture relationships and establish your brand as a valuable resource.

Set Non-Lead-Gen Goals: Engagement is Key

While lead generation is the ultimate goal, don’t overlook the importance of non-lead-gen metrics. Set specific engagement goals for each post, such as increasing comments, likes, or shares. This engagement not only helps build a community around your brand but also provides valuable insights into your audience’s preferences and interests.

Visuals Speak Louder: Incorporate Eye-Catching Images

In the world of social media, visuals reign supreme. Incorporate eye-catching images into your posts to boost engagement and click-through rates. Images break up text-heavy content, making it more visually appealing and easier to digest. Use high-quality photos, infographics, and videos to capture your audience’s attention and drive traffic to your website.

Consider Advertising: Target Your Ideal Audience

Facebook advertising offers a powerful way to reach targeted audiences and promote your content to potential customers who may not yet be followers. Utilize Facebook’s advanced targeting options to pinpoint specific demographics, interests, and behaviors that align with your ideal customer profile. This targeted approach ensures that your content is seen by the people who are most likely to be interested in what you have to offer.

Q: How often should I post on Facebook to generate leads?

A: Consistency is crucial. Aim to post at least once a day, with a mix of lead-generating and non-lead-generating content.

Q: What is the ideal length for a Facebook post?

A: Keep your posts concise and to the point. Aim for around 100-200 words, with a clear call-to-action.

Q: How can I track the success of my Facebook lead generation efforts?

A: Use Facebook’s built-in analytics tools to track key metrics such as post reach, engagement, and lead conversions. Regularly review your data and make adjustments as needed.
